Ниже HTML сайта: введите описание изображения здесь
Я пытаюсь получить код python, чтобы вернуть тег после product-card__title и product-card__price, где я хочу, чтобы он возвращал имя и цену обуви.
Я попытался запустить приведенный ниже код, но я не получил именно того, что хочу.
url = 'https://kith.com/collections/mens-footwear-sneakers'
r = requests.get(url)
soup = BeautifulSoup(r.content,'html.parser')
ex = soup.find('ul',{'class': 'collection-products'})
for i in ex.find_all('a'):
print(i.text)
Это то, что возвращается
Nike Air Force 1 '07 LV8
NY vs NY
$110.00
И так далее. Я просто хочу иметь возможность использовать soup.select для очень специфического тега c после класса «product-card__title» или «product-card__price», например, для adidas x Pharrell Williams Boost Slide и $ 100.